| Abstract | A kind of low complexity inter-frame coding algorithm based on vector quantization (VQ) is presented in this paper. There are three inter encode modes according to the motion type of the image block. Not-encode mode is adopted by static block, residual mean coding mode is adopted by the smooth motion block, VQ and mean encode mode are adopted by general motion block. The motion type of the image block is determined by the moving threshold TH and smoothing threshold T. The size of each encode block is adjusted adaptively by the size of the static region or smoothing motion region. Simulations show that this algorithm can get great rate distortion performance, especially for the head shoulder sequences with large static and smoothing background. PSNR can be achieved at 35.63dB, while the compression rate can be achieved at 150.38, and bit rate with frame rate of 10fps is 50.69kbps. The quality and bit rate can meet the visual and bandwidth requirements in the application of video telephony communications. |
